What Is Crypto Arbitrage?

Crypto arbitrage involves buying a cryptocurrency at a lower price on one exchange and selling it at a higher price on another. For example:

This strategy exploits minor price discrepancies across exchanges due to market volatility.

Types of Crypto Arbitrage Trading

1. Pure Spot Arbitrage

Buy low on one exchange, sell high on another—instant profit.

2. Positional Arbitrage

Hold positions across exchanges, closing them when prices converge favorably.

3. Interest Rate Arbitrage

Borrow crypto at a low interest rate on one platform, lend it at a higher rate elsewhere.
